  "account": "No Man's Sky fans should prepare for an imminent update, as Sean Murray is using emojis to signal it. The next update, codenamed Cosmos, is expected to be significant. Murray has previously used emojis to tease updates, starting with an egg for the Living Ship update in 2020. Each subsequent emoji has become a reliable indicator of the upcoming update's release. The latest emoji posted by Murray is a gleaming cocktail glass, which fans have interpreted as a hint that Cosmos is close to release. Historically, Murray's emojis have appeared when the next update is just a few days away. Assuming the pattern holds, Cosmos could bring major changes to the game. Fans hope for a major update marking the 10th anniversary of No Man's Sky, with possibilities ranging from a complete galaxy overhaul to planets with multiple biomes. Additionally, fans are expecting more options for galactic traversal and an overhaul of the game's technical underpinnings to enable vibrant in-game communities and a more persistent universe. Whether Cosmos will bring these changes remains to be seen, but Murray's continued use of emojis suggests the update is on its way.",
